No Man’s Land
Harold Pinter's tragicomic gem No Man’s Land (Thursday 4 – Saturday 6 April) sees two ageing writers, Hirst and Spooner, meet in a Hampstead pub and return to Hirst’s stately house nearby for a late-night session of witty banter, disturbing power games and the worship of alcohol. This unique and haunting play is part mystery drama, part homage to the ghosts of the past and the fiction of memory.
